Whether the U.S. Federal District Court of Minnesota is the appropriate venue and jurisdiction to present an appeal for a tort suit against the Social Security Administration (SSA) when submitted on Standard Form 95
QUESTION(S) PRESENTED 1) Is the U.S. Federal District Court of Minnesota the appropriate venue and jurisdiction to present an Appeal for a suit Sounding in Tort against the Social Security Administration (SSA) when correctly submitted on Standard Form 95, Prescribed by the Department of Justice (Form No. NSN 7540-00-634-4046). 2) Do the words “arising under” as applied to benefit claims under U.S. Code, Title 42, Chapter 7, Subchapter II § 405(h) by previous courts also apply to the _ law when said claim is presented as a separate suit for tortfeasance. 3) Does the precedence of common law (stare decisis) set for Corporate Appellants regarding timeliness also apply to Pro-Se Appellants.
